South Korea Buys Israeli Radar Tech to Counter North's Missiles

(Times of Israel) Judah Ari Gross - South Korea announced on Tuesday that it was purchasing two advanced Green Pine radar systems from Israel for $292 million to improve its ability to detect incoming missiles, like those of North Korea. Seoul said the systems could "spot and track ballistic missiles from a long distance at an early stage." South Korea already possesses earlier versions of the Green Pine system, purchased in 2009. The new model has an improved operational range and the ability to track multiple projectiles in the air simultaneously.
